Subject: [pbs-devel] [PATCH proxmox-backup 1/5] pbs-config: add delete_authid to ACL-tree

... allows the deletion of an authid from the whole tree. Needed
for removing deleted users/tokens.
Signed-off-by: Hannes Laimer <h.laimer@proxmox.com>
---
pbs-config/src/acl.rs | 71 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 71 insertions(+)
diff --git a/pbs-config/src/acl.rs b/pbs-config/src/acl.rs
index 89a54dfc..a4a79755 100644
--- a/pbs-config/src/acl.rs
+++ b/pbs-config/src/acl.rs
@@ -280,6 +280,13 @@ impl AclTreeNode {
roles.remove(role);
}
+ fn delete_authid(&mut self, auth_id: &Authid) {
+ for (_name, node) in self.children.iter_mut() {
+ node.delete_authid(auth_id);
+ }
+ self.users.remove(auth_id);
+ }
+
fn insert_group_role(&mut self, group: String, role: String, propagate: bool) {
let map = self.groups.entry(group).or_default();
if role == ROLE_NAME_NO_ACCESS {
@@ -411,6 +418,14 @@ impl AclTree {
}
}
+ /// Deletes a user or token from the ACL-tree
+ ///
+ /// Traverses the tree in-order and removes the given user/token by their Authid
+ /// from every node in the tree.
+ pub fn delete_authid(&mut self, auth_id: &Authid) {
+ self.root.delete_authid(auth_id);
+ }
+
/// Inserts the specified `role` into the `group` ACL on `path`.
///
/// The [`AclTreeNode`] representing `path` will be created and inserted into the tree if
@@ -1010,4 +1025,60 @@ acl:1:/storage/store1:user1@pbs:DatastoreBackup
Ok(())
}
+
+ #[test]
+ fn test_delete_authid() -> Result<(), Error> {
+ let mut tree = AclTree::new();
+
+ let user1: Authid = "user1@pbs".parse()?;
+ let user2: Authid = "user2@pbs".parse()?;
+
+ let user1_paths = vec![
+ "/",
+ "/storage",
+ "/storage/a",
+ "/storage/a/b",
+ "/storage/b",
+ "/storage/b/a",
+ "/storage/b/b",
+ "/storage/a/a",
+ ];
+ let user2_paths = vec!["/", "/storage", "/storage/a/b", "/storage/a/a"];
+
+ for path in &user1_paths {
+ tree.insert_user_role(path, &user1, "NoAccess", true);
+ }
+ for path in &user2_paths {
+ tree.insert_user_role(path, &user2, "NoAccess", true);
+ }
+
+ tree.delete_authid(&user1);
+
+ for path in &user1_paths {
+ let node = tree.find_node(path);
+ assert!(node.is_some());
+ if let Some(node) = node {
+ assert!(node.users.get(&user1).is_none());
+ }
+ }
+ for path in &user2_paths {
+ let node = tree.find_node(path);
+ assert!(node.is_some());
+ if let Some(node) = node {
+ assert!(node.users.get(&user2).is_some());
+ }
+ }
+
+ tree.delete_authid(&user2);
+
+ for path in &user2_paths {
+ let node = tree.find_node(path);
+ assert!(node.is_some());
+ if let Some(node) = node {
+ assert!(node.users.get(&user2).is_none());
+ }
+ }
+
+ Ok(())
+ }
}
